Tianjin blasts damage cars, facilities: Japan marques
Published Fri, Aug 14, 2015 · 09:50 PM
Tokyo
SEVERAL Japanese carmakers including Toyota Motor Corp reported damage to cars and facilities after two huge explosions at the Chinese port of Tianjin tore through an industrial area where toxic chemicals and gas were stored.
The blasts in the city of Tianjin on Wednesday night killed at least 50 people, including a dozen fire fighters, state media said. About 700 people were injured.
